How much does a 24 foot aluminum extension ladder weight?

A 24 foot aluminum extension ladder typically weighs anywhere from 50-70 lbs, depending on the design and construction of the ladder. Extension ladders are constructed with heavy duty aluminum, which makes them lightweight and durable, but keeps them heavier than comparable fiberglass ladders.

Because of the extended heights of extension ladders, they can be more cumbersome to transport and carry than other ladders. Additionally, because they are very tall, they should be used cautiously and only after referring to the manufacturer’s safety instructions.

Do telescopic ladders fail?

Telescopic ladders are very convenient and popular pieces of equipment, and there is no denying the usefulness of having a ladder that is compact and easy to transport. However, telescopic ladders are not without some potential weaknesses and failure points.

Just like any other type of ladder, telescopic ladders can fail if they are misused, over-extended, overloaded, or otherwise damaged. Because they are made of lightweight aluminum, they may not handle significant weight as well as heavier-duty ladders.

They may also suffer from corrosion or other wear and tear if not maintained properly. Additionally, telescopic ladders often have moving parts and locking mechanisms to keep them secure in their extended or collapsed states.

These components can break or wear down over time, leading to wobble, instability, or even the ladder completely collapsing.

It is important to always follow the manufacturer’s instructions for the safe use and maintenance of any telescopic ladder. Always make sure that it is securely locked in place, that the weight load is not exceeded, and that inspection and repairs are done as needed to ensure that errors or issues are not missed.

Following these steps can help to minimize the chances of a telescopic ladder failure, but ultimately, like any other piece of equipment, they can fail due to age, damage, misuse, and so on.

Are telescoping ladders OSHA approved?

Yes, telescoping ladders are approved for both commercial and residential use according to Occupational Safety and Health Administration (OSHA) standards. They are considered a safe form of access for certain jobs, as long as certain safety measures are taken.

All telescoping ladders must be inspected before each use to ensure the ladder is in good condition and not damaged, components are properly attached and locked, braces are operational, and rungs are intact.

Furthermore, they must be used on a stable and level surface, and on a solid, non-slippery foundation. Telescoping ladders must also be used with a three-point contact, meaning both hands and a foot or both feet and a hand are in contact with the ladder at all times.

It is also important not to exceed their maximum weight capacity and that they are not used near electrical lines or other hazards. When used correctly, telescoping ladders can provide adequate and safe access to elevated areas.

What size telescoping ladder do I need?

When determining the size of telescoping ladder you need, it is important to consider the height you need to reach and the load capacity the ladder must accommodate. Telescoping ladders come in a variety of sizes from four to twelve feet, with some extending up to twenty-two feet.

If you are reaching a height of seven to nine feet, a four or six-foot telescoping ladder should suffice. For heights of ten to twelve feet, a six or eight-foot ladder works. Reaching heights of thirteen to fifteen feet requires an eight to ten-foot ladder while sixteen to eighteen feet needs at least a twelve-foot ladder.

Another factor to consider is the weight of the user and the items they will be carrying. Telescoping ladders typically range from 150 to 300 pounds in terms of load capacity. This means you should check the capacity of the ladder to ensure it can accommodate the weight of the user and any items being carried on the ladder.

Overall, you will need to take both the height and weight into consideration when deciding which size telescoping ladder you need.
